From 7283191071daed79d66dac281f5b314248ed829f Mon Sep 17 00:00:00 2001 From: Mark Jenkins Date: Mon, 8 Sep 2014 15:26:22 -0500 Subject: [PATCH] upgraded to up-to-date jetty and wicket --- pom.xml | 12 ++++++---- solr-rocks/pom.xml | 24 +++++-------------- .../geoclusterrocks/SearchPage.java | 2 +- .../geoclusterrocks/WicketApplication.java | 8 +------ 4 files changed, 15 insertions(+), 31 deletions(-) diff --git a/pom.xml b/pom.xml index 3c90c3b..33418fe 100644 --- a/pom.xml +++ b/pom.xml @@ -14,11 +14,13 @@ 1.7 true true - - 1.4.21 - - - 8.1.2.v20120308 + + + 6.17.0 + 7.6.13.v20130916 + + + none 1.7.7 4.9.0 diff --git a/solr-rocks/pom.xml b/solr-rocks/pom.xml index bbae68c..91bcdd8 100644 --- a/solr-rocks/pom.xml +++ b/solr-rocks/pom.xml @@ -59,14 +59,8 @@ org.apache.wicket - wicket + wicket-core ${wicket.version} - - - org.slf4j - slf4j-api - - @@ -89,20 +83,14 @@ - - org.eclipse.jetty - jetty-server + org.eclipse.jetty.aggregate + jetty-all-server ${jetty.version} - compile + provided + - - org.eclipse.jetty - jetty-webapp - ${jetty.version} - compile - @@ -140,7 +128,7 @@ org.mortbay.jetty jetty-maven-plugin - 8.1.7.v20120910 + ${jetty.version} 0 diff --git a/solr-rocks/src/main/java/ca/markjenkins/geoclusterrocks/SearchPage.java b/solr-rocks/src/main/java/ca/markjenkins/geoclusterrocks/SearchPage.java index 249092b..c2fa1b3 100644 --- a/solr-rocks/src/main/java/ca/markjenkins/geoclusterrocks/SearchPage.java +++ b/solr-rocks/src/main/java/ca/markjenkins/geoclusterrocks/SearchPage.java @@ -11,7 +11,7 @@ import org.apache.solr.client.solrj.SolrServerException; import org.apache.solr.client.solrj.impl.HttpSolrServer; import org.apache.solr.client.solrj.response.QueryResponse; -import org.apache.wicket.PageParameters; +import org.apache.wicket.request.mapper.parameter.PageParameters; import org.apache.wicket.markup.html.WebPage; import org.apache.wicket.model.IModel; import org.apache.wicket.model.LoadableDetachableModel; diff --git a/solr-rocks/src/main/java/ca/markjenkins/geoclusterrocks/WicketApplication.java b/solr-rocks/src/main/java/ca/markjenkins/geoclusterrocks/WicketApplication.java index f667fd9..d68bbe2 100644 --- a/solr-rocks/src/main/java/ca/markjenkins/geoclusterrocks/WicketApplication.java +++ b/solr-rocks/src/main/java/ca/markjenkins/geoclusterrocks/WicketApplication.java @@ -1,12 +1,6 @@ package ca.markjenkins.geoclusterrocks; import org.apache.wicket.protocol.http.WebApplication; -import org.apache.wicket.request.target.coding.HybridUrlCodingStrategy; -import org.apache.wicket.util.file.File; - -import java.io.FileInputStream; -import java.io.IOException; -import java.io.InputStream; /** * Application object for your web application. If you want to run this application without deploying, run the Start class. @@ -32,6 +26,6 @@ public Class getHomePage() protected void init() { super.init(); - mount( new HybridUrlCodingStrategy( "search", SearchPage.class ) ); + mountPage("/geosearch", GeoSearch.class ); } }